Autor Thema: Esera ECO10 Controller Sensor Probleme  (Gelesen 841 mal)

Offline Deckoffizier

  • Sr. Member
  • ****
  • Beiträge: 576
Esera ECO10 Controller Sensor Probleme
« am: 04 Mai 2021, 10:37:49 »
Hallo,

bin leider als Laie jetzt mit meinem Latein Total am Ende nach Tagelangen probieren.
Meine Sensoren liefen   alle      bisher unter OWX problemlos.

Die DS1820B Tempsensoren werden auch weiterhin problemlos ausgelesen.
Obwohl der Controller hat einen 1820(HZVorlauf) als fehlerhaft erkannt und habe ich entfernt.

An meinen Temp/Feuchte Sensoren von tm3d beiße ich mir die Zähne aus.

Der mit extra auf der Platine sitzende DS1820 Temp Sensor wird bei allen richtig ausgelesen.
Der mit im ? Chip DS2438 verbaute interne Temp Wert wird normal mit etwas Abweichung zum DS1820 auch richtig ausgelesen
soweit so gut.

Aber.... an die Feuchte Werte(humidity) komme ich einfach nicht zu Rande.
Habe aus dem 66 EseraMulti alle Varianten der Firma Esera Nummern durchgespielt
bzw. der in der Device spezific help.

Zeitweise kommen plausible Werte aber meistens steht humidity auf 2.55.
Auch bei der Angabe des reinen DS2438 Devices also ohne die Nutzung der ? "vorgefertigten" Esera Formeln
komme ich auf keinen grünen Zweig um Werte Änderungen zu erkennen um eine angepasste Formel zu finden.

Meine Bitte wer hat einen Rat?
Anbei list vom Controller und  ein Sensor.
Die Sreenshots sind einmal als Esera Nummer 11121 und 11135.

Internals:
   DEF        192.168.10.5
   DEFAULT_DATATIME 10
   DEFAULT_POLLTIME 5
   DeviceName 192.168.10.5:5000
   FD         20
   FUUID      60843200-f33f-cca1-09de-a5fe52d2379e8dd7
   KAL_PERIOD 60
   NAME       EseraOneWireController1
   NR         363
   PARTIAL   
   RECOMMENDED_FW 12029
   STATE      opened
   STATUS     ready
   TYPE       EseraOneWire
   DEVICE_TYPES:
     0B031673855CFF28 DS1820
     260000059FC82428 DS1820
     2E03000084DBEC26 11135
     3B00000CA8373E28 DS1820
     680000022891CA26 11121
     6F00000CAC0CCA28 DS1820
     750000025DEB3326 11135
     80000000DBD0A912 DS2408
     8003000084DB1826 11203
     970000086A9EA228 DS1820
     BB0120120AED8B28 DS1820
     D2000001525F5E26 11135
     DB03000084DB1728 DS1820
     EA0000086AAB5128 DS1820
     F203000084DBE826 11135
     FD000005A0F29528 DS1820
   ESERA_IDS:
     0B031673855CFF28 9
     260000059FC82428 1
     2E03000084DBEC26 13
     3B00000CA8373E28 4
     680000022891CA26 14
     6F00000CAC0CCA28 3
     750000025DEB3326 16
     80000000DBD0A912 10
     8003000084DB1826 12
     970000086A9EA228 2
     BB0120120AED8B28 7
     D2000001525F5E26 15
     DB03000084DB1728 8
     EA0000086AAB5128 5
     F203000084DBE826 11
     FD000005A0F29528 6
   READINGS:
     2021-05-03 12:55:25   state           ready
   TASK_LIST:
Attributes:
   comment    Typ ECO10 im Wandschrank
   dataTime   10
   pollTime   3
   room       OneWire

und der Sensor

Internals:
   DEF        EseraOneWireController1 680000022891CA26 11121
   DEVICE_TYPE 11121
   ESERAID    14
   EseraOneWireController1_MSGCNT 3334
   EseraOneWireController1_TIME 2021-05-04 10:02:31
   FUUID      60843fca-f33f-cca1-3d4d-c31d8e72a053ff55
   IODev      EseraOneWireController1
   LASTInputDev EseraOneWireController1
   MSGCNT     3334
   NAME       Wz_Feuchte
   NR         371
   ONEWIREID  680000022891CA26
   STATE      22.2°C 2.5%Feuchte
   TYPE       EseraMulti
   Helper:
     DBLOG:
       humidity:
         myDbLog:
           TIME       1620115339.52121
           VALUE      2.55
   READINGS:
     2021-04-30 09:12:20   VAD             2.55
     2021-04-30 09:12:20   VCC             1
     2021-04-30 09:12:20   VSense          111.11111
     2021-05-04 10:02:31   dewpoint        111111.11
     2021-05-04 10:02:31   humidity        2.55
     2021-05-04 10:02:31   temperature     22.16
     2021-05-04 10:02:31   voltage         0
Attributes:
   DbLogInclude humidity
   alias      Wohnzimmer_Feuchte
   event-on-change-reading humidity,temperature
   room       EseraMulti,Wohnung->Wohnzimmer
   stateFormat {sprintf("%.1f",ReadingsVal("Wz_Feuchte","temperature",0)) ."°C " .sprintf("%.1f",ReadingsVal("Wz_Feuchte","humidity",0)) ."%Feuchte"}

Gruß

Hans-Jürgen
FHEM 5.8 auf "yakkaroo Emu A1FL.1" mit CUL 868MHz, SIGNALduino,1 Wire USB Busmaster, diverse 1 Wire Sensoren,Landroid,Aeotec USB Dongle Z-Wave Plus

Offline Deckoffizier

  • Sr. Member
  • ****
  • Beiträge: 576
Antw:Esera ECO10 Controller Sensor Probleme
« Antwort #1 am: 07 Mai 2021, 14:59:22 »
Hallo,

kurzer Zwischenstand von mir.
Habe 2 Sensoren einmal Abgassensor und einen Temp/Feuchte Sensor vom Bus genommen.
Damit hat sich erst mal die Lage stabilisiert und die Feuchte Werte werden jetzt an den anderen Sensoren konstant
ausgegeben.
Habe in Erfahrung gebracht , das es sich bei der Ausgabe von 2.55 hauptsächlich um ein Busproblem
bei zu vielen Daten, Verkabelung etc. handelt.
Bin noch weiterhin am Ball.

Gruß
Hans-Jürgen
FHEM 5.8 auf "yakkaroo Emu A1FL.1" mit CUL 868MHz, SIGNALduino,1 Wire USB Busmaster, diverse 1 Wire Sensoren,Landroid,Aeotec USB Dongle Z-Wave Plus

Offline Prof. Dr. Peter Henning

  • Developer
  • Hero Member
  • ****
  • Beiträge: 8178
Antw:Esera ECO10 Controller Sensor Probleme
« Antwort #2 am: 16 Mai 2021, 05:35:21 »
Der DS2438 belastet den Bus mit ziemlich viel Traffic.

LG

pah

 

decade-submarginal